Output 14fa904b38cb433c79003f986575ae72fa3591c79ecd1271f8fba44afda85fe2:1

value
136458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b776204bcc546d72d0c5a676bed57886d10b7ead OP_EQUAL
address
2N9yH9wNFGdeY6qxouwgMo8ZWBs2LzMJTPY
transaction
14fa904b38cb433c79003f986575ae72fa3591c79ecd1271f8fba44afda85fe2
confirmations
83152
spent
true